Increased expression with differential subcellular location of cytidine deaminase APOBEC3G in human CD4(+) T-cell activation and dendritic cell maturation
Immunology and cell biology, Aug 18, 2016
APOBEC3G (A3G) is an innate defense protein showing activity against retroviruses and retrotransp... more APOBEC3G (A3G) is an innate defense protein showing activity against retroviruses and retrotransposons. Activated CD4(+) T-cells are highly permissive for HIV-1 replication, while resting CD4(+) T-cells are refractory. Dendritic cells (DCs), especially mature DCs, are also refractory. We investigated whether these differences could be related to a differential A3G expression and/or sub-cellular distribution. We found that A3G mRNA and protein expression is very low in resting CD4(+) T-cells and immature DCs, but increases strongly following T-cell activation and DCs maturation. The Apo-7 anti-A3G monoclonal antibody, which was specifically developed, confirmed these differences at the protein level and disclosed that A3G is mainly cytoplasmic in resting CD4(+) T-cells and immature DCs. Filogenia De La Región Del Gen Pol Que Codifica La Integrasa De Los Retrovirus Phylogeny of the Gene Pol Region That Encodes by Retroviral Integrases
ABSTRACT RESUMEN Contexto: La integrasa de los retrovirus cataliza la inserción covalente de una ... more ABSTRACT RESUMEN Contexto: La integrasa de los retrovirus cataliza la inserción covalente de una copia del cDNA viral en el genoma de la célula hospedera. La enzima es codifica por el extremo 3' de la región proviral Pol; presenta tres dominios estructurales: un amino-terminal (1-46 aa), uno central o catalítico (46-219 aa) y uno carboxi-terminal o de unión al ADN (220-300 aa). Objetivos: Definir las relaciones filogenética intra-específica y inter-específicas de miembros de la familia Retroviridae. Métodos: A partir de 28 secuencias completas de la IN de diferentes géneros de retrovirus se calcularon, utilizando el método de Kimura doble parámetro, las distancias genéticas entre los diferentes dominios de la proteína de la integrasa y se definieron sus relaciones filogenéticas. Los árboles filogenéticos se obtuvieron mediante los métodos de NJ y MP con bootstraps de 500. Resultados: Se obtuvo una filogenia de la familia Retroviridae representada por cinco " clados " diferentes. Esta distribución fue similar a las obtenidas previamente con secuencias LTR y de envoltura. Se caracterizaron secuencias canónicas de aminoácidos en el dominio N-terminal (HHCC) y en el dominio central catalítico (DTDGEK). Se determinó que los distintos dominios de las integrasas de miembros de la familia Retroviridae mostraron una amplia variación genética (5,0 a 0,68). El dominio central catalítico presentó el menor rango de distancias genéticas (1,91 a 0,44). Conclusión: Los resultados confirman aquellos previamente obtenidos para LTR y env; en su conjunto, éstos son una evidencia fuerte de que estarían operando mecanismos similares de evolución para los genes retrovirales pol yenv.

[Use of non-occupational HIV post-exposure prophylaxis in Spain (2001-2005)]
Enfermedades Infecciosas Y Microbiologia Clinica, Nov 1, 2008
BACKGROUND: Non-occupational post-exposure prophylaxis for human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) inf... more BACKGROUND: Non-occupational post-exposure prophylaxis for human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) infection is widely used, although there is little available scientific evidence to support its effectiveness. The aim of this study is to describe the characteristics of the persons exposed, types of exposures, antiretroviral treatment prescribed, and outcome of HIV infection in cases of non-occupational exposure in Spain.METHOD: The data used included all cases of accidental HIV exposure notified to the Non-occupational Post-exposure Prophylaxis Information System between January 2001 and December 2005. Non-occupational exposure to HIV was defined as accidental contact with blood and/or other biological fluids outside the healthcare setting.RESULTS: A total of 993 cases of exposure were notified (569 men [57.3%]); median age was 30 years (range: 1-87). Exposure was sexual in 53.1%, parenteral in 39.8%, and other types in 7.2%. The source person was identified in 82.7% of cases. Antiretroviral treatment (ART) was prescribed in 528 cases (53.2%), with triple therapy in 68.2%. A total of 54.2% returned for the 6-month visit among patients receiving ART and 61.1% among those without this therapy (P < 0.05). One or more side effects developed in 135 (32.4%) cases, and there were 18 treatment interruptions (4.3%). Three seroconversions to HIV were notified (0.3%).CONCLUSIONS: A national registry for monitoring non-occupational post-exposure prophylaxis to HIV is needed because of the high number of cases notified, the considerable incidence of side effects, and the difficulties of follow-up.

In this study, we evaluated the incidence and management of depressive symptoms during IFN-α therapy in HIV-infected patients with CHC. Methods: HIV-infected patients with CHC who began IFNα and ribavirin therapy during the recruitment period April 2001 to April 2003 were included in the study. Patients with a history of major depressive disorder were excluded. Results: Of 113 co-infected patients who started IFN-α therapy during the recruitment period, 45 (40%) developed symptoms of depression (sadness, tiredness and apathy). Twenty of them (44%) were treated with citalopram, a selective serotonin re-uptake inhibitor, resulting in a significant improvement in their symptoms. Most of the patients (60%) showed depressive side effects in the first 3 months after initiation of IFN-α. In addition, during the study, three patients developed psychotic symptoms and one committed suicide.

The genetic variation and population structure of three populations of Anopheles darlingi from Co... more The genetic variation and population structure of three populations of Anopheles darlingi from Colombia were studied using random amplified polymorphic markers (RAPDs) and amplified fragment length polymorphism markers (AFLPs). Six RAPD primers produced 46 polymorphic fragments, while two AFLP primer combinations produced 197 polymorphic fragments from 71 DNA samples. Both of the evaluated genetic markers showed the presence of gene flow, suggesting that Colombian An. darlingi populations are in panmixia. Average genetic diversity, estimated from observed heterozygosity, was 0.374 (RAPD) and 0.309 (AFLP). RAPD and AFLP markers showed little evidence of geographic separation between eastern and western populations; however, the F ST values showed high gene flow between the two western populations (RAPD: F ST = 0.029; Nm: 8.5; AFLP: F ST = 0.051; Nm: 4.7). According to molecular variance analysis (AMOVA), the genetic distance between populations was significant (RAPD:Φ ST = 0.084; AFLP:Φ ST = 0.229, P < 0.001). The F ST distances and AMOVAs using AFLP loci support the differentiation of the Guyana biogeographic province population from those of the Chocó-Magdalena. In this last region, Chocó and Córdoba populations showed the highest genetic flow.

Microwave‐oven drying of rice leaves for rapid determination of dry weight and nitrogen concentration
Http Dx Doi Org 10 1080 01904169409364720, Nov 21, 2008
ABSTRACT Predicting the need for fertilizer‐nitrogen (N) topdressing based on plant N status is a... more ABSTRACT Predicting the need for fertilizer‐nitrogen (N) topdressing based on plant N status is an important N management strategy for increasing both grain yield and N‐use efficiency of irrigated rice. Plant N analysis by conventional‐oven drying and micro‐Kjeldahl procedure generally requires several days. Accurate estimation of leaf N content per unit dry weight (Ndw) at different growth stages by the chlorophyll meter requires that meter‐reading values (SPAD values) be adjusted for specific leaf weight (SLW). This study demonstrated that a microwave oven can be used for drying rice leaves for quick estimation of leaf dry weight without significantly influencing the estimation of Ndw by micro‐Kjeldahl procedure. Microwave oven drying of 0.5 g (dry weight) leaf samples required only two minutes. Extended exposure duration up to six minutes did not alter the measured Kjeldahl N concentration. Specific leaf weight determined with microwave‐oven drying improved the prediction of Ndw by SPAD. The chlorophyll meter with SLW adjustment can provide another tool to make rapid, in‐season diagnosis of crop N status.
